When translated from greek, a doula is defined as “a serving woman.” A doula’s role is to provide education, emotional support, and physical support through pregnancy, childbirth, and the immediate postpartum period. Below you will find package options - there’s something for every mama.

  • This session is for the mom who wants to better understand the mechanics of the second stage of labor - pushing.

    You will learn how the inner unit works to deliver babies, what positions are available to you for pushing, how to maximize maternal positioning for your comfort and efficiency, and how to prepare the pelvic floor for childbirth.

    It is recommended to complete this session between weeks 35-37.

    This virtual session runs 60 minutes.
